Over 11,000 'moonlighting' public employees uncovered

Civil servants garner over 6 million euros from unauthorized pay

13 March, 12:44
Over 11,000 'moonlighting' public employees uncovered (ANSA) - Rome, March 13 - More than 11,700 state employees and consultants received pay for unauthorized work outside of their public contracts in 2012, Italian finance police said on Wednesday.

A special investigative police unit monitoring compliance with rules governing civil service and transparency in public administration carried out probes into state-contracted workers' for 2012.

The unit found 859 of those civil servants received payments of approximately six million euros from a second job that was not authorized by the government body for which they work.
